Título:
Formation and synchronization of autocatalytic noise-sustained structures under Poiseuille flow
Autor/es:
A. D. SÁNCHEZ, G. G. IZÚS Y R. R. DEZA
Revista:
PHYSICA A - STATISTICAL AND THEORETICAL PHYSICS
Editorial:
ELSEVIER SCIENCE BV
Referencias:
Lugar: Amsterdam; Año: 2012 vol. 391 p. 4070 - 4080
ISSN:
0378-4371
Resumen:
The formation and synchronization of 2D noise-sustained structures are investigated for Gray?Scott kinetics in packed-bed reactors under Poiseuille flows, when identical systems are submitted to independent spatiotemporal Gaussian white noise sources. A finite-wavelength instability is theoretically predicted and numerically confirmed for uncoupled reactors. In particular, noise-sustained structures that flow with viscous boundary conditions are numerically observed above threshold. When the systems are coupled in master?slave configuration, the numerical simulations show that the slave system replicates to a very high degree of precision the convective patterns arising in the master one due to the selective amplification of noise. The nature of the synchronization and the stability of the synchronization manifold are elucidated.
